在Kafka中,引导服务器(bootstrap server)是客户端用于发现和连接Kafka集群的初始地址。通常情况下,更改引导服务器需要重启Kafka客户端,以便客户端能够重新连接到新的引导服务器。
然而,Kafka提供了一种动态更新引导服务器的机制,即使用Kafka的元数据(metadata)功能。通过使用元数据功能,Kafka客户端可以在不重启的情况下更改引导服务器。
具体步骤如下:
这种方式的优势在于可以动态地更改引导服务器,而无需重启Kafka客户端,从而实现无缝切换到新的引导服务器。这对于需要在运行时更改引导服务器的场景非常有用,例如在Kafka集群发生故障或进行维护时。
在腾讯云的产品中,可以使用腾讯云的消息队列 CKafka 来实现 Kafka 的功能。CKafka 提供了灵活的配置和管理选项,可以方便地进行引导服务器的更改。您可以通过腾讯云 CKafka 的官方文档了解更多信息:CKafka 产品文档。
领取专属 10元无门槛券
手把手带您无忧上云